Performance Power

Choosing a gaming laptop under $1000 requires paying close attention to its performance power. A recent multi-core processor like an Intel Core i5 or AMD Ryzen 5 is vital to handle demanding games and multitasking smoothly. Make sure it has at least 16GB of DDR4 or DDR5 RAM to support seamless gameplay without lag. A dedicated graphics card, such as an NVIDIA GTX or RTX series, is essential for high-quality visuals and better performance. Fast storage options like a 512GB or larger NVMe SSD help reduce load times and keep the system responsive. Additionally, consider the thermal design and cooling system to prevent overheating during extended gaming sessions. These factors guarantee your gaming experience remains powerful, smooth, and enjoyable without overspending.

Graphics Capability

Since the GPU primarily determines a gaming laptop’s graphics performance, paying close attention to the graphics card is essential. In laptops under $1000, you’ll typically find mid-range GPUs like NVIDIA GTX or RTX 30-series, or AMD Radeon graphics. These are capable of handling most modern games at medium to high settings, giving you solid visual quality and smooth frame rates. Features like ray tracing and DLSS support can considerably enhance realism and performance, even on budget-friendly models. Additionally, a GPU with 4GB or more VRAM helps manage higher resolutions and detailed textures more effectively. Compatibility with your laptop’s display resolution and refresh rate also plays a role in delivering a seamless gaming experience, especially in fast-paced or competitive titles.

Display Quality

A great display can make or break your gaming experience, especially on a budget. A full HD (1920×1080) screen provides sharp, clear visuals that bring games to life. An IPS panel offers better color accuracy and wider viewing angles, so you see vibrant images from different positions. A higher refresh rate, like 120Hz or 144Hz, ensures smoother gameplay and reduces motion blur, giving you a competitive edge. Brightness levels of 300 nits or more improve visibility in bright environments and enhance overall visual quality. Additionally, features like G-Sync or FreeSync help maintain visual consistency and eliminate screen tearing. Prioritizing these display qualities means you’ll enjoy immersive, crisp, and fluid gaming, even on a budget.

Battery Life

Choosing a gaming laptop under $1000 means balancing performance with battery life to keep you gaming longer without being tethered to a power outlet. Typically, these laptops offer between 4 to 8 hours of battery life, depending on how you use them and their hardware. Lighter processors like AMD Ryzen 5 or Intel Core i5 tend to conserve power better, extending usage time. However, high-refresh-rate displays and advanced graphics can drain the battery faster due to increased power demands. Battery capacity, measured in watt-hours (Wh), also matters—higher ratings generally mean longer playtime. Additionally, enabling power management settings and lowering screen brightness can help maximize your battery life during gaming sessions. Finding the right balance assures you get good performance without sacrificing longevity.

Are Upgrade Options Available for Laptops in This Price Range?

Yes, upgrade options are available for laptops under $1000, but they can be limited. I usually look for models that allow RAM and storage upgrades, which can boost performance and extend the laptop’s lifespan. Keep in mind, some components like the CPU or GPU are often soldered and not upgradeable. So, I recommend choosing a laptop with some upgrade potential, especially for RAM and SSD, to get the best value.
